Okay, okay, okay. Prospective time! Here's the kind of thing I'd like to see in this next game.

  • Weapon balancing. I kind of feel like there should be an actual point to every given weapon, like there's a reason you should still consider using them throughout the game. I think this'd be helped by making more holdout areas aside from a handful of casinos. There should be a purpose in mind for every weapon you find lying around, instead of just being a gun for the sake of being a gun. Also, seriously, weapon mods were way too unreliable to find, and way too expensive for their effects. A pistol made slightly more powerful is not worth the 1,000 caps to get those mods when a gun that outclasses it in every way can be found just down the road.

  • Less stupidly-exclusive items. Seriously, New Vegas had a fuckton of absolutely pointless pieces of apparel or useless items that could only be found in one or two places. It eats the OCD in me. I must have an EVERYTHING. But really, basic and simple clothing should be reliable to find. There should be stores that sell that kind of stuff or something.

  • More extensive customization. I want to be able to cosmetify my guns and armor. And I think armor should be less of a simple catch-all thing and more of a layered system, like older RP Gs and stuff. So power armor comes in chestplates, backpacks, legs, shoes, arms, gloves, and helmets, with a Recon Suit acting as undergarments. But then, that might annoy some. I dunno, give people the ability to merge armor sets into a single item for easier management?

  • Hardcore mode being more hardcore. It felt a bit less like a desperate bid for survival and more like a minor annoyance what with all the massive amounts of consumables I'd amassed. Make it more tense and important to the core gameplay, and not some passing thing you have to remember.

  • Some level of intelligence to NP Cs. Seriously, it's ridiculous that I'm encouraged to be shady and holding a chainsword to murder dozens of NCR soldiers behind their backs to sell their armor, all because if I do it right there's no consequences. They should've gotten suspicious and alerted to what's going on, indicated by a...let's call it a caution meter. It's something related to the reputation thing, except not instant. It'd basically work like...if a corpse is observed by a person of the same faction, they become wary, and start alerting everyone else. As long as you're sticking around, that meter doesn't go down, unless you come into the room in a faction uniform, in which case it'll slowly go down a bit. If the meter fills up, however, it causes a hit to your reputation, regardless of if anyone actually saw you kill that person. This happens faster if you have a bad rep, and slower if you're more favored among them.

  • A 3D map, a la Metroid Prime. I've found the maps more or less nonsense in multi-level rooms, and being able to see a clearer representation of the place would help a bit more.

  • No stupid invisible walls. Just...no.
